Critical Thinking On Assisted Suicide. Physician-assisted suicide and euthanasia all have a common goal of voluntarily terminating one’s life by administering a lethal substance directly or indirectly assisted by a physician. In physician-assisted suicide, the physician provides the necessary information, and the patient performs the act while in.
